Netflix is gearing up for the release of 'Parasyte: The Grey' aka 'Gisaengsu: Deo Geurei', a South Korean Sci-Fi-Horror series slated to premiere on April 5.

The show draws inspiration from the manga series 'Kiseiju' by Hitoshi Iwaaki, which was originally published from 1988 to 1995 in Kodansha's Afternoon magazine.

However, 'Parasyte: The Grey' introduces viewers to a fresh narrative, featuring new characters while retaining the essence of the original concept.

What is the plot of 'Parasyte: The Grey' aka 'Gisaengsu: Deo Geurei'?

In 'Parasyte: The Grey' aka 'Gisaengsu: Deo Geurei', a bizarre event occurs when strange parasites rain down from the sky. These parasites infiltrate humans, using them as hosts and posing a threat to humanity by both infecting and killing them.

As the parasites organize themselves, humans are forced into a battle to prevent their world from being overtaken.

Jung Su-In (Jeon So-Nee) becomes a unique case when a parasite attempts to control her but fails to take over her mind. Instead, Jung Su-In and the parasite find themselves coexisting.

Meanwhile, Seol Gang-Woo (Koo Gyo-Hwan) embarks on a mission to track down parasites in hopes of locating his missing younger sister.

At the Centre of the fight against the parasites is Choi Joon-Kyung (Lee Jung-Hyun), the leader of the parasite task force. Her determination to eradicate them stems from the loss of her husband to the parasitic threat, making it her life's mission to eliminate them.

The official synopsis reads, "When unidentified parasites violently take over human hosts and gain power, humanity must rise to combat the growing threat."

'Parasyte: The Grey' aka 'Gisaengsu: Deo Geurei' main cast

Koo Kyo-hwan

Koo Kyo-hwan is a well-known South Korean actor and film director recognized for his roles in various movies.

He has appeared in films such as 'Jane', 'Peninsula', and 'Escape from Mogadishu'. Additionally, he gained recognition for his role in the Netflix original series 'D.P'.

Jeon So-nee is a South Korean actress managed by Management SOOP.

She gained prominence in 2020 for her role in the Korean TV series 'When My Love Blooms', where she starred alongside Park Jin-young.

Jeon's mother, Ko Jae-sook, was part of the 1970s K-pop musical duo Bunny Girls. She completed her education at the Seoul Institute of the Arts.

Lee Jung-hyun, occasionally known as Ava, is a South Korean singer and actress, born on February 7, 1980.

She gained initial recognition for her acting talent, earning awards for her debut film.

Lee has established herself as one of South Korea's leading international talents, thanks to her successful singing career.

Renowned for introducing the techno music genre to Korea, she is often referred to as the Techno Queen.
